As I'm sure every Game of Thrones fan has seen evidence of, during 2015's San Diego Comic-Con, Sansa Stark herself, Sophie Turner, licked a surprisingly life-like mask of Tyrion Lannister. This year, Turner went on Conan and explained the story behind her licking the Tyrion mask. Her explanation? Though she admitted not much of the night is memorable for her (she was, apparently, "in a happy state"), she did remember enough to explain that a fan came up to her in a Tyrion mask, and her, “being the loyal wife that I am, I just gave it a quick lick.” I mean, why not?

The most insane thing about the mask is that it definitely looks like Tyrion actor Peter Dinklage's actual face — to the point where Turner actually said that people thought she was licking Dinklage's face, and not that of a mask. To that, Turner said, "I’m not going to do anything to dispel those rumors, Peter’s a sexy guy. He has a wife, so I don’t think he’d be too pleased.”

I think the biggest lesson to be learned from this is, where does one get a mask that is as terrifyingly life-like as the mask Turner licked? After doing a little investigating, I can tell you it's actually easier than you'd think! It turns out, that exact mask was on eBay for a while: According to TMZ, soon after the images of the actress licking the mask became known, creator Landon Meier did not wash the mask or fix the hair Turner had licked before he put it up for auction on eBay with an asking price of $5000. Unfortunately, someone has already purchased the mask — but never fear, Meier has a company called Hyperflesh, so there could always be more GoT masks where the Tyrion one came from.
